Output 86de0c9abd6ca43f88b43bc1b88405767a66043ec36ffb1b589d353ec0b9543e:0

value
2509898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d61cff8b4379d30d501fea296f94b66060e642f OP_EQUAL
address
3BfNkaRt7Gbqi27Z1j8KJ6sLz2mMYWeYjC
transaction
86de0c9abd6ca43f88b43bc1b88405767a66043ec36ffb1b589d353ec0b9543e
spent
true